WebMortgage insurance is not cheap, often adding between $50-$150 to your monthly mortgage payment for typical prices in the Fort Hood, TX market. The three types of mortgage insurance are below for each loan type: FHA Loan = MIP. Conventional Loan = PMI. VA Loan = VA Funding Fee. These are not items you, the buyer, shop around for. WebJun 21, 2024 · As of 2024, the VA will back a loan up to $548,250, which means the VA would guarantee 25% ($137,062) of that if you defaulted. 5 Anything beyond that won’t be backed by the VA. Sound dangerous? It can be! You won’t have to pay private mortgage insurance (PMI).
